Toxoplasma Gondii - a parasite bred through cat poop. It is extremely common, easily spread through undercooked food (especially meat). It can affect your mental state to engage in riskier and more self destructive behaviors. Testing for Toxoplasma Gondii is not standard, but it is believed that 10-15% of the US population is infected with the parasite at any given time.

Not quite- in Appalachia, most homes have a porch. Appalachia is, generally speaking, quite a muggy place, so most people sleep inside and then spend their time outside on the porch. The porch plays the same role as a living room or den in other parts of the US.

A porch thief is basically the same as any other burglar, but they will (almost) exclusively steal from porches because it is often less risky than stealing from the rest of the house.

Because of the important role of a porch as a primary living area, porch thieves can make off with family heirlooms, money, games, furniture, children's toys, and even TV sets.
